Bathroom countertop options for South Florida homes

Bathroom countertops serve a different role than kitchen surfaces. They face constant moisture exposure from steam, splashing, and condensation; daily contact with cleaning products, hairspray, nail polish remover, and cosmetics; and temperature swings from hot styling tools set directly on the surface. The right material choice depends on whether you are updating a powder room vanity, rebuilding a master bath double-vanity, or installing a full-slab wet area in a luxury condo. Moisture is the defining factor in bathroom material selection. In South Florida's humidity, bathrooms without adequate ventilation can keep surfaces damp for hours, which accelerates staining on unsealed stone and encourages mildew growth at silicone joints. We fabricate and install bathroom countertops across Broward, Palm Beach, and Miami-Dade counties using quartz, marble, granite, quartzite, and porcelain — each with distinct advantages for bathroom environments. Quartz offers the lowest maintenance and strongest stain resistance for daily-use vanities—hair dye, toothpaste, and makeup wipe off without leaving marks. Marble delivers the classic luxury aesthetic that many homeowners want for master bathrooms but requires sealing and careful avoidance of acidic products like certain face washes and lemon-based cleaners. Granite provides natural beauty with solid durability and tolerates the heat from curling irons and flat irons better than quartz. Porcelain is completely non-porous and ideal for pool bathrooms and outdoor showers. Our team helps you match the right material to your bathroom usage, aesthetic goals, and maintenance tolerance.

Best materials for bathroom vanity countertops

Quartz is the most popular bathroom countertop material in South Florida — it resists staining from toothpaste, makeup, hair dye, and skincare products without sealing. For kids' bathrooms and guest baths that see heavy, unpredictable use, quartz is the low-risk choice. Marble is the aspirational choice for master bathrooms, offering soft veining and warmth that photographs beautifully but requires annual sealing and careful avoidance of acidic products—this includes many popular face washes, toners, and cleaning sprays that contain glycolic acid, salicylic acid, or citrus extracts. If you choose marble for a bathroom, switch to pH-neutral cleaners and keep a small tray under frequently used bottles to prevent ring marks. Granite works well in family bathrooms where durability matters more than uniformity — each slab is unique, and granite tolerates the heat from styling tools placed briefly on the surface better than quartz or marble. Quartzite combines the visual appeal of marble with significantly better scratch and etch resistance, making it ideal for high-end bath renovations where aesthetics and durability both matter—Taj Mahal and Mont Blanc quartzite are among the most requested for luxury master baths in our market. Porcelain slabs are gaining traction for bathrooms near pools, cabanas, and outdoor showers because they are completely non-porous, UV-stable, and unaffected by humidity or chlorine splash.

Standard vanity sizes and custom fabrication

Bathroom vanity countertops range from 24-inch single-sink powder room tops to 72-inch or longer double-vanity surfaces in master bathrooms. Standard depths are 22 inches, but custom depths of 17 to 20 inches accommodate wall-mounted floating vanities popular in modern condos, while deeper 24- to 25-inch tops suit vessel sinks that need more counter space around the basin. For ADA-compliant installations in commercial bathrooms or aging-in-place renovations, we fabricate to specific clearance and height requirements. We template every bathroom individually because walls are rarely perfectly straight—especially in South Florida condos where concrete walls can bow up to half an inch over a five-foot span—and sink placements need precise alignment with existing plumbing rough-ins. Moving plumbing to accommodate a new vanity layout adds cost and complexity, so we work with your plumber to optimize the design around existing drain and supply positions whenever possible. For undermount sinks, the cutout must match the exact sink model — we measure the actual unit, not catalog dimensions, because manufacturer specs can be off by an eighth of an inch. Have your sink on-site or ordered before the template appointment. Most bathroom countertop projects in South Florida take 5-7 business days from template to installation, shorter than kitchen projects because of the smaller scope.

Undermount sink installation for bathroom countertops

Undermount bathroom sinks create a cleaner look and make the vanity surface easier to wipe down — water sweeps directly from counter to basin without catching on a rim. The sink is secured to the underside of the stone with mechanical clips and adhesive, then sealed at the joint. We coordinate with your plumber on drain alignment and faucet placement before fabrication. Popular undermount options include rectangular troughs for modern bathrooms, oval basins for transitional styles, and integrated stone sinks for luxury installations. Every undermount cutout is polished smooth and sealed to prevent moisture intrusion.

Bathroom countertop pricing in South Florida

Bathroom countertop projects typically cost less than kitchen installations because of the smaller surface area. A standard single-vanity quartz top (24 to 36 inches wide) runs $400-$800 installed, depending on edge profile and sink cutout complexity. Double-vanity tops (48 to 72 inches) range $800-$1,800 for quartz or granite, $1,200-$3,000+ for marble or quartzite. Full master bath projects — vanity plus tub deck, shower niche, bench, and full-slab splash walls — can range $2,000-$6,000+ depending on material and total square footage. Vessel sink installations cost slightly less in fabrication because there is no undermount cutout polish required—just a drain hole—but the countertop needs to be cut to accommodate the specific vessel bowl dimensions. We provide exact pricing after measuring your space. Remnant pieces from kitchen projects can significantly reduce bathroom countertop costs—a 30-inch vanity top can often be cut from a remnant that would otherwise go unused, saving 30 to 50 percent on the material cost. If you are flexible on color and material, ask about our current remnant inventory before committing to a full slab purchase. This is especially practical for powder rooms and guest baths where a smaller piece of premium material like Calacatta marble becomes affordable as a remnant.
